Contaminants Covered: What’s Really Out There?

Now, let’s peek under the hood of what contaminants we’re worrying about. You’ve got your pathogens—those pesky bacteria and viruses—and then there are suspended solids, which can make your water look like a mud puddle (not ideal, right?). We can’t forget about heavy metals like lead or mercury; they can be pretty toxic, especially over time. And hey, chemicals like pesticides can sneak into our water supply too, thanks to agricultural runoff. The water treatment process tackles these threats systematically, making sure they’re effectively removed.

The Process: How Does it Work?

Water treatment involves a series of steps to purify water, starting with coagulation and flocculation, where chemicals are added to form clumps. Then we have sedimentation, where those clumps sink to the bottom, and finally, filtration and disinfection come into play to remove any remaining impurities. You see, each part of the process plays a crucial role in achieving that safe, clean water that we all rely on.
